Hi Tuning, I run www.freearticlesdirectory.com which uses article dashboard, and it works fine. I get about 200 articles submitted every day, and it can get a bit labour intensive as most people don't submit to the correct category, or they include too many links in their text. So beware when you take on an articles directory, as I figure you need at least 10,000 articles before you start to make any money. i have a few sites using this script (article dashboar-d)- its ok but it really is a pain to make any changes cause it is encrypted and the wont help you at all .. I finally had my own script made and I got 10 times better results with getting the pages indexed. another thing is there are people who find vulnarabilities in widely used script like this and then hack them and put their own links over the entire directory and hijack your list ... problem is with it encrypted its hard to make it more secure or figure out where the vulnerabilities are.
